Johnsonville Recalls 95,000 Pounds of Sausage Due to Choking Hazard

Johnsonville Sausage is voluntarily recalling 95,000 pounds of its Jalapeno Cheddar Smoked Sausage due to the possibility that it may contain bits of hard green plastic which could potentially be a choking hazard.

Currently, Johnsonville has only received one report of plastic being found in this sausage, but due to the size of the plastic found, the voluntary recall was deemed necessary.

Check your fridge for 14oz maroon-colored packages that have a “best by” date of 06/09/2019, and “EST.34224” inside the USDA mark of inspection. Note that if you’ve recently purchased Jalapeno Cheddar Smoked Sausage in the red, white and blue seasonal packaging, that is safe to consume.

The USDA says that consumers who have purchased these products are urged to throw them away or return them to the place of purchase.
